How Is Aluminum Sulfate Used In Water Treatment. Aluminium sulphate, or alum {al 2 (so 4) 3}, is the coagulant of choice for many industrial and wastewater treatment applications due to its high efficiency, efficacy in clarifying, and utility as a sludge dewatering agent. The chemical has no aftertaste and is very excellent in removing turbidity. Ferric sulfate, aluminum sulfate, or ferric chloride, classed as aluminum or iron salts, are common coagulants for water treatment. Alum, also known as aluminum sulfate, acts as a flocculant in water treatment, aiding in the removal of suspended particles. Aluminum sulfate is a compound that is used as a sedimentation agent in the treatment of drinking water and also finds applications in various. A coagulant is a chemical that is used to remove suspended solids from drinking water. Aluminium sulphate (alum), an inorganic salt, is the most widely used coagulant in wastewater treatment, due to its proven performance, cost.
